A preschool teacher in Homestead, Florida, was arrested and charged with child abuse without great bodily harm.
Heather Williams, a 41-year-old teacher at Smart Start of Homestead, was taken into custody on Wednesday.
According to police, Williams pushed and grabbed a 3-year-old student by the arm, resulting in visible bruises.
Williams stood before Miami-Dade Circuit Judge Mindy S. and was later released on bond.
Administrators at Smart Start of Homestead did not immediately respond to requests for comment.
